Detection of the bubbles

The initial images are noisy and have non uniform intensity (depends on the lighting). The first step is to reduce noise and to remove the background of the image.

But : remove the non-uniform intensity

Then, we enhance the contraste and we segment the image: A toggle mapping is used to enhance the image and the segmenation is a simple automatic threshold. (Fisher method).

From left to right : toggle mapping, automatic segmentation and area opening (suppression of the small particles).

Binary image processing: various stages of mathematical morphology are applied, dilation close hole, the ultimate erosion and many more...

